Courses

Required courses: ACM 116, CDS 140a, CDS 201, CDS 202 + 5 additional courses (CDS or math/applied math)

Fall Winter Spring
Math CDS 201 (operator theory) CDS 202 (differential geometry)
ACM 105 (functional analysis)
ACM 113 (convex optimization)
CDS 15x (Bayesian modeling)
Dynamical Systems ACM 116 (stochastic systems) ACM 216 (Markov chains)
CDS 140a (dynamical systems)
ACM 217 (stochastic calculus)
CDS 140b (dynamical systems)
Control Systems CDS 110a (feedback systems)
CDS 212 (control theory)
CDS 110b (optimization-based control)
CDS 213 (robust control)
CDS 270-x (special topics)
